怎么让excel某行固定不动

怎么让excel某行固定不动

要让Excel中的某行固定不动,可以使用冻结窗格功能、将该行转换为表格、或者使用VBA宏来实现。 冻结窗格是最简单且常用的方法,具体操作是在Excel的视图选项卡中选择冻结窗格,然后选择冻结首行或冻结首列。以下我们将详细介绍这些方法,并探讨它们的优缺点和适用场景。

一、冻结窗格

1.1 基本操作

冻结窗格是Excel中最常用的功能之一,可以帮助用户在滚动大数据表格时保持某些行或列可见。操作步骤如下:

  1. 选择“视图”选项卡。
  2. 点击“冻结窗格”按钮。
  3. 选择“冻结首行”或“冻结首列”。

1.2 自定义冻结范围

如果你需要冻结特定的行和列,可以按以下步骤操作:

  1. 选择你想要冻结的行下方和列右方的单元格。例如,如果你想冻结第1行和第2列,你需要选择单元格C2。
  2. 点击“视图”选项卡。
  3. 选择“冻结窗格”下拉菜单,然后选择“冻结窗格”。

这种方法适用于大多数情况下的表格固定需求。优点是操作简单,几乎不需要学习成本;缺点是只能冻结连续的行或列,不能选择不连续的区域。

二、使用表格功能

2.1 转换为表格

Excel表格功能也可以帮助你固定某行或某列不动。具体操作如下:

  1. 选择你需要的表格区域。
  2. 点击“插入”选项卡。
  3. 选择“表格”。
  4. 在弹出的对话框中勾选“表包含标题”,然后点击“确定”。

2.2 表格的优点

将数据转换为表格不仅能固定首行,还能带来其他管理上的优势,如自动筛选、排序和公式管理。优点是功能强大,适合复杂数据管理;缺点是转换为表格后某些原有格式可能会丢失,需要重新调整。

三、使用VBA宏

3.1 编写VBA宏

对于需要更高自定义需求的用户,可以使用VBA宏来实现行或列的固定。以下是一个简单的示例代码:

Sub FreezeRow()

Rows("2:2").Select

ActiveWindow.FreezePanes = True

End Sub

将上述代码粘贴到VBA编辑器中并运行,即可冻结第2行。

3.2 适用场景

VBA宏适用于复杂需求和需要自动化的场景。优点是灵活性高,可以满足多样化的需求;缺点是需要一定的编程基础,对初学者不太友好。

四、常见问题与解决方法

4.1 冻结窗格无效

有时候冻结窗格功能可能会失效,这通常是由于工作表处于受保护状态。解决方法如下:

  1. 取消保护工作表。
  2. 重新应用冻结窗格。

4.2 表格转换后格式丢失

在将数据区域转换为表格后,可能会出现格式丢失的情况。这时可以手动调整格式,或者在转换前保存格式设置。

4.3 VBA宏错误

如果运行VBA宏时出现错误,首先检查代码是否正确,然后确认选择的行或列是否存在。如果问题依旧,建议查阅相关文档或寻求专业帮助。

五、应用案例

5.1 财务报表管理

在财务报表中,通常需要冻结首行以便在滚动时保持标题可见。通过冻结窗格或表格功能,可以有效管理大数据量的报表。

5.2 数据分析

在数据分析中,冻结某些关键行或列有助于保持数据的可读性。例如,冻结首列可以在横向滚动时保留关键指标名称。

5.3 项目管理

在项目管理的甘特图或任务列表中,冻结首行可以帮助项目经理在查看任务详情时保持任务名称可见,从而提高工作效率。

六、总结

总的来说,冻结窗格、表格功能和VBA宏是实现Excel某行固定不动的主要方法。冻结窗格简单快捷,适用于大多数场景;表格功能强大,适合复杂数据管理;VBA宏灵活性高,适用于定制化需求。根据实际需求选择合适的方法,可以大大提高数据处理的效率和准确性。

相关问答FAQs:

1. 如何在Excel中固定某行不动?
在Excel中,您可以使用“冻结窗格”功能来固定某行不动。请按照以下步骤进行操作:

  • 选择您想要固定的行号所在的行,例如第一行。
  • 在Excel的菜单栏中选择“视图”选项卡。
  • 在“视图”选项卡中,点击“冻结窗格”按钮下的“冻结顶端行”选项。
  • 这样,您选择的行就会被固定在顶端,无论您向下滚动表格,该行都会保持可见。

2. 在Excel中,如何锁定某行并使其在滚动时保持可见?
如果您希望在滚动Excel工作表时保持某行可见,可以使用“窗口分割”功能来实现。请按照以下步骤进行操作:

  • 选择您希望锁定的行号所在的行,例如第一行。
  • 在Excel的菜单栏中选择“视图”选项卡。
  • 在“视图”选项卡中,点击“窗口分割”按钮下的“拆分”选项。
  • 这样,您选择的行将会被锁定在窗口的顶部,并且无论您向下滚动表格,该行都会保持可见。

3. 如何在Excel表格中固定一行不动以便进行数据对比?
要在Excel表格中固定一行以便进行数据对比,您可以使用“冻结窗格”功能。请按照以下步骤进行操作:

  • 选择您想要固定的行号所在的行,例如第一行。
  • 在Excel的菜单栏中选择“视图”选项卡。
  • 在“视图”选项卡中,点击“冻结窗格”按钮下的“冻结顶端行”选项。
  • 这样,您选择的行将会被固定在顶端,无论您向下滚动表格,该行都会一直可见,方便您进行数据对比。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4906941

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部